Lots of clinics will see you without insurance but you may have to set up a payment plan, or they may see you for a reduced fee if you give them proof of income. Some clinics get grant money that pays them to see patients who don't have insurance. Call your local community mental health center (often clinics that provide this kind of help will have "community" in their title) and see what they can offer.
